A podcast by MAKENA. Siena and Toast, two Hawaii girls, talk about being gay, Asian-American, mostly-vegan, lessons learned as performing and recording singer-songwriters, and their relationship. Plus, listener contests, laughing, inspiration, and encouragement.

We visit San Diego Wild Animal Park, do more Hawaiian Pidgin English talking, and answer a question about our experience in the lesbian community regarding transgender issues.   (Pictured: Siena with a lion cub)

    Clarification for the people who are not from Hawai'i.

    "Ne ne" is Japanee and "moi moi" is Hawaiian and mean da same ting: sleep. So usage depends I tink what yore et-nic background stay.

    One moa ting: Camme try call in yore message on da Makena website cuz wuz kine-a hahd for read um. Probly cuz we all stay bilingual even if we went grow up in Hawai'i. We are required (forced?) to speak, read, write "standard" English in order to make it in this society. Onee recently Lee Tanouchi wen make pidgin more standardized and maybe we gotta go back school for learn da kine way for spell like dat. I hea now days pidgin qualify for first language wen you sign up for college.
